Role
As the Document and Data Controller for Large Projects Offshore Netherlands (LON) you are responsible to monitor, check and analyse the quality of structured and unstructured data and documents. You will monitor and manage the relations between data and data entities and report on quality. In addition to this you will also monitor and report on timeliness of data and workflows. The knowledge you gather from these activities will help us to further make the transition to being a data centric enterprise. TenneT LON is making the transition from a document oriented to a data centric way of working. The position of Data Analyst is a direct result of this and therefore a new role in the Project Management Office. Since we are in the transition phase, you will also be required to perform quality checks on incoming documents.
Your main responsibilities
– Analyzes and interprets data files, retrieving missing or inconclusive data.
– Ensures data correctness, completeness, and reliability.
– Manages data relations and monitors data drop cycles in ThinkProject and other systems.
– Controls metadata from contractors and tracks connections between data and assets.
– Performs complex system mutations and ensures compliance with quality standards.
– Develops workflows, user manuals and participate in data quality projects.
– Perform quality checks on project related documents.
– Identifies bottlenecks, proposes improvements and support the document manager.
